Curve 55770cb2

55770 = 2 · 3 · 5 · 11 · 132



Data for elliptic curve 55770cb2

Field Data Notes
Atkin-Lehner 2- 3+ 5- 11+ 13+ Signs for the Atkin-Lehner involutions
Class 55770cb Isogeny class
Conductor 55770 Conductor
∏ cp 320 Product of Tamagawa factors cp
Δ 7.8591113689707E+22 Discriminant
Eigenvalues 2- 3+ 5-  0 11+ 13+ -2  4 Hecke eigenvalues for primes up to 20
Equation [1,1,1,-20266230,-32431027725] [a1,a2,a3,a4,a6]
Generators [-16210:151075:8] Generators of the group modulo torsion
j 190713967472892532969/16282209155097600 j-invariant
L 8.9398975542879 L(r)(E,1)/r!
Ω 0.071542157661072 Real period
R 6.2479926847484 Regulator
r 1 Rank of the group of rational points
S 0.99999999999306 (Analytic) order of Ш
t 4 Number of elements in the torsion subgroup
Twists 4290d2 Quadratic twists by: 13
